How to think about r/nbatalk
This community is dedicated to serious discussions about basketball, focusing on the NBA and its various aspects, including player performances, team strategies, and league news. Members engage in in-depth analysis, debate current events, and share insights about the sport. The distinctiveness of this community lies in its emphasis on thoughtful conversation rather than casual banter, making it a go-to place for basketball enthusiasts who seek a more analytical approach to the game.

Audience
Participants in this community are primarily basketball fans, ranging from casual viewers to die-hard analysts. The demographic includes a mix of ages, with a significant number of younger adults who are passionate about the NBA. Members are generally looking for a platform to discuss their insights, share opinions, and engage in debates, fostering a vibe that is both competitive and respectful among basketball aficionados.
Posting culture
The posting culture encourages well-researched content, including statistics, game analyses, and thoughtful commentary. Posts that lack depth or are overly promotional tend to receive downvotes. Members often engage in discussions following games, trades, or significant league events, with a cadence that peaks during the NBA season. Quality over quantity is valued, and members appreciate posts that contribute meaningfully to ongoing conversations.

How many subscribers does r/nbatalk have?
r/nbatalk has approximately 260,073 subscribers as of May 27, 2026.
When was r/nbatalk created?
r/nbatalk was created on July 30, 2021 (5 years ago).
